Transaction 65240194e60e318f6abab18d7afaa20579329770dfc539248a023fe59fdc7708
1 Input
2 Outputs
- 65240194e60e318f6abab18d7afaa20579329770dfc539248a023fe59fdc7708:0
- 65240194e60e318f6abab18d7afaa20579329770dfc539248a023fe59fdc7708:1
value 5000000000
address 32JGzipxScMe2S3BLqCXUzBZE2XcFEv58T
value 14999992275
address 143GsjgXwFRK5kAKHSKvjUk1twCD34fUuE